Yes, this is a real photo of me — and yes, it was as painful and crappy as it looks. Long story short, we switched to a heavy-duty cleaning soap in our butcher shop. It was totally odourless, so I didn’t think twice… until 10–15 minutes later when my eyes got insanely itchy. The next morning I woke up with my eyes swollen shut and my lips huge. Terrifying, uncomfortable, and honestly? It sucked.
I had no idea it was the soap. I changed all my makeup, kept a food journal, did all the “normal” things — even made multiple emergency room trips, only to get pill-pushed with no real answers.
It wasn’t until I shared my story on Instagram that a customer messaged me. She had the exact same reaction and told me to look for an ingredient called propylene glycol — a chemical hiding in tons of cleaners, cosmetics and, you guessed it, the soap we were using. Turns out if you’re allergic, the fumes attack your sweat glands and sensitive areas.


Once I finally figured out the source, we got rid of that soap immediately. The problem was the residue — it was everywhere on our cut floor: equipment, walls, the whole space. It took 2–3 weeks of wash-downs (my amazing staff kept me out of the room) before it was completely gone. I was still having minor flare-ups just from the lingering fumes, but once everything was cleaned and I tossed the makeup products that also contained the chemical, the reactions stopped.

WHY THE NAME “CAMDEN TALLOW”?
Camden Tallow is a tribute to our roots. Our family has lived and farmed on this land for nearly a century. The farm was originally part of Camden Township — where Josh’s grandfather, Robert Butler, began our family’s story in 1930.
When we created this skincare line, we wanted a name that honoured our history, our land, and the generations who built this farm with intention and hard work.
Camden Tallow is our nod to where it all began — and the legacy we’re proud to continue.
